SCANIA

Scania is a leading supplier of solutions and services for sustainable transport, as well as engines for industrial and marine applications and power generation.

Scania 64-tonne electric truck on the road with Wibax

Scania:  A 64-tonne electric truck has been delivered to chemical supplier Wibax and will operate on the roads of northern Sweden. The 3-axle electric tractor contributes to Wibax reaching its climate targets and is yet another example of Scania innovating in close partnership with a customer.

Scania endorses global Memorandum of Understanding for zero-emission vehicles

Scania:  On COP26 Transport Day, Scania announces another strong commitment to zero-emission vehicles with its endorsement of a first ever global Memorandum of Understanding (MoU) on zero-emission trucks and buses. It is a coordinated effort by governments and industry leaders that have agreed to support and work towards the MoU goals and to facilitate net-zero carbon emissions by 2050. The initiative is driven by CALSTART and the government of the Netherlands

Scania builds extremely heavy and extra-long electrified truck for Jula Logistics

Scania:  The Swedish company Jula Logistics uses a 32 metres Scania truck as High Capacity Transport to be able to bring more cargo for each transport and consequently lower emissions. Now it’s time for the next step: the huge truck will be powered by electricity. This is the latest example of a sustainable transport solution that Scania develops in close collaboration with a progressive customer.

Scania invests further in Northvolt expansion and battery recycling

Scania:  Scania’s partnership with Northvolt is about developing and commercialise battery cell technology for heavy vehicles. It started in 2018, and when Northvolt now completes another equity raise of 2.75 billion US dollars to deploy further battery cell capacity and enforce recycling, Scania is among the investors yet again.
